Job Overview

We are seeking a dedicated Speech-Language Pathology Assistant (SLPA) for a full-time, school-based position in Gerber, CA for the upcoming school year. This role offers the opportunity to support a diverse student population while working alongside a virtual Speech-Language Pathologist (SLP) in a collaborative educational setting.

The SLPA will provide services to students across multiple specialized programs, including extensive needs classrooms, Deaf and Hard of Hearing programs, preschool students, and general education populations.

Key Responsibilities

  • Provide speech and language therapy services under the supervision of a licensed SLP
  • Implement therapy plans and IEP goals developed by the supervising SLP
  • Work with students with a variety of communication needs, including speech, language, articulation, and social communication disorders
  • Support students using AAC devices and alternative communication systems
  • Collect therapy data and maintain accurate documentation
  • Collaborate with teachers, special education staff, and families to support student success
  • Assist with progress monitoring and implementation of communication strategies in educational settings

Caseload Details

The SLPA will support students in:

  • TK–4 Extensive Needs Programs
  • TK–8 Regional Deaf and Hard of Hearing Program
  • State Preschool Programs
  • TK–8 Elementary Students
  • K–12 educational settings requiring speech and language support

Qualifications

  • Active California Speech-Language Pathology Assistant (SLPA) License
  • Associate's or Bachelor's Degree meeting California SLPA requirements
  • School-based, pediatric, or special education experience preferred
  • Experience with AAC devices, Deaf and Hard of Hearing populations, or special needs students is a plus
  • Strong communication, organization, and collaboration skills
